That Horrific Sound in the Dark of the Night
The cool night air stings like razors carving my skin as I violently toss the covers away in a tangled pile.
That sound!
That horrific, yet familiar sound that has stolen me from the warmth of my dreams, now leaves me jolted upright, legs dangling over the edge of my bed.
Shivering, through my body and the whole of my mind. Shivering and incoherent thoughts prevail.
That sound! There it is again.
BLEUCH…BLEUCHAAA…BLECH BLECH BLECH BLECH BLECH……BLEUCHAAAHHH
I catapult myself off the bed and stumble across the frigid hardwood, weary of every foot placement on landing.
Feeling like a drunk naked mole rat, and quite possibly looking like one, I stretch my still shivering arms; hoping, praying that I will find what I’m looking for before it’s too late.
Where are you, wall?
Where are you, light switch?
My hands reach the smooth painted drywall, moving upward, downward, left, right - searching, searching.
Aha!
I feel the edge of the switch plate, move my fingers to the switch, and my body one step closer to…
Splat, squish, ooze
Warm, gelatinous, slimy fuzziness slides between my toes, cooling as it nestles on the top of my foot in a hairy ball of “what the hell, Abigail!”
I heel-step back across the room to my bed, throw myself down on the edge, and snatch the one remaining Kleenex from the box on my night table.
Damn it!
I penguin-march to the washroom, grab a wad of tissue paper from the roll, and remove what’s left of the disgusting goo from my foot. The warm washcloth that follows settles my stomach as the mild soapy scent replaces the vomit-inducing odor of whatever-the-heck-that-was.
After scraping and mopping the rancid mess off the floor, it’s finally time to shut down the lights, climb back into bed, and find solace in the warmth of my down comforter.
As I lay my head on the pillow, I feel a tiny thump on the mattress and a small, furry grey-and-white head rub against my shoulder.
mew mew
Completely unignorable. No matter how much I try, she’s completely unignorable.
I pull an arm out from under the blankets to scratch her ears as she settles beside me, hoping she’ll soon get bored and move on.
purrrrrr puurrrr purrrrrrrrrrr
The soothing vibration relaxes me and I feel myself slipping back into dreamland as she moves away and jumps off the bed.
Now snuggled, warm and comfy under the covers, near fully asleep, all is right with the world again……. until
That sound!
